Namaste friends,

 

Along the lines of other short homam manuals that are available on the homam

website below, a short Shiva homam manual is available now. This homam is simple

and short enough to be performed daily or weekly or monthly.

 

It has many options for the main mantra used. Instead of doing a little of each

mantra and covering many mantras, I suggest picking any ONE mantra and doing it

as many times as one can. If one is unable to choose a mantra, I suggest

Mrityunjaya mantra. If one wants a simpler mantra, I suggest " Om hreem

namashshivaaya " . However, there are many options in the manual.

Company of fire has a highly beneficial effect on mind and homam (fire ritual)

is far more effective than japam (meditation) in purifying mind and removing

obstacles. Almost all the remedial measures (upayas) taught by Maharshi Parasara

in Brihat Parasara Hora Sastram (BPHS) involve homam and not japam. As the

internal purifying fire within individuals becomes weaker with deepening Kali

yuga, value of external fire in meditation increases. Meditation without an

external fire is much slower and less efficient for most people.
